Abstract
This paper has integrated the automatic monitoring system of water resources, and fully excavated the monitoring information contents, and introduced information fusion technology, and discussed and analyzed information collection and transmission and processing, and brought forward the system which has versatility and portability and scalability by using geographic information systems and databases and other tools. The system can provide decision support for flood control and drainage management and simulation and prediction of water environment and the supply and demand analysis of water resources, these will greatly improve the management and decision-making level of water resources, and furnish reliable guarantee for economic and social development.
